Nokia N97 Smartphone is it all that bad?

At TR?

First off, are you sure there isn't one?

Second, TR isn't a consumer hardware review site, so no, not every product will be mentioned. Check CNet or Endgaget or whatever so such reviews. (And please, no comment on whatever favorite review site you might have that I didn't mention. )

Edit: Further, how does the lack of mention at any particular site imply "bad"?